Problem Recognition: Triggers, Processes, and Cognitive Biases

The initial method of consumer decision creation is need identification , a crucial occurrence spurred by various cues. These might include personal alerts, like feeling hunger , or public factors such as advertising or observing people . The cognitive process isn’t always straightforward ; it's often shaped by cognitive biases – distortions in judgment that result in us to misperceive what we require . Examples include accessibility bias , where fresh events disproportionately shape our view, and loss aversion , which prompts us to escape perceived damages even more than gaining equivalent advantages .

Real-World Examples of Awareness Science in Action

Beyond research papers, recognition psychology is actively shaping our common experiences. Consider how retailers utilize strategic product placement; placing desirable items at shelf-level to maximize visibility and encourage purchases – a direct application of the Gestalt principles. Similarly, the widespread use of product logos and recognizable color schemes in advertising leverages the familiarity effect, causing us to prefer companies simply because we’ve seen them before. Furthermore, the layout of websites and mobile apps, prioritizing easy navigation and clear calls to response, illustrates a deep knowledge of how humans process and react to visual information. Lastly, the impact of public service announcements that use familiar scenarios to encourage safe behaviors highlights the power of recognition psychology in driving positive change.
